About Argemira

Argemira represents clients in high-stakes litigation and investigations. She has experience managing all aspects of civil litigation in state and federal courts on a range of issues, including privacy and data security, complex contracts, fraud, and First Amendment disputes. She counsels clients across industries such as technology, transportation and healthcare.

Argemira maintains an active pro bono practice. As a fifth-year associate at her prior firm, she first-chaired a jury trial representing a prisoner in a Section 1983 excessive force case, resulting in a $23,500 award for her client. She has also served as a secondee with Her Justice, offering free legal services to low-income women in New York City.

During law school, Argemira served as a mediator with the New York Peace Institute and the US Equal Employment Opportunity Commission. She also gave workshops on various forms of alternative dispute resolution to the Delhi High Court in India and the United Nations’ New York diplomatic corps.
